What is the purpose of the United Nations Global Compact?

  1. To increase tariffs on international trade

  2. To align business operations with ten key principles

  3. To promote monopolies within industries

  4. To standardize currency across nations

The correct answer is: To align business operations with ten key principles

The purpose of the United Nations Global Compact is specifically to align business operations with ten key principles that focus on human rights, labor, the environment, and anti-corruption. By encouraging companies to adopt these principles, the initiative aims to promote responsible corporate citizenship and sustainable development. Participating organizations are encouraged to integrate these values into their business strategies and operations, creating a positive impact on society and the environment. This alignment fosters a commitment among businesses to contribute to a more sustainable and equitable global economy. The other options suggest directions that contradict the Global Compact's mission. Increasing tariffs could hinder international cooperation, promoting monopolies undermines fair competition and innovation, and standardizing currency is more of a financial agreement between nations rather than a focus of the Global Compact, which is centered on ethical business practices and social responsibility.
